Turn Off Alarms Using the Alarm Switch
If you’re about to leave for a vacation and want to completely disable your alarms, the Restore 3 makes it a breeze. Simply locate the Alarm switch on the back of the device. Slide it backward, and your alarms will be deactivated. You can confirm it’s in the correct position by checking for a small red indicator.
To turn your alarms back on, just slide the switch forward. The red indicator will vanish, signaling that the alarms are active again. This method is the quickest and easiest way to manage the alarm settings on your Hatch Restore 3.

Turn Off Alarms Using the Hatch Sleep App
You can conveniently disable your Hatch Restore 3 alarms remotely through the Hatch Sleep mobile application. This is the same app utilized to set your alarms and manage your various routines. To deactivate alarms from the Hatch Sleep app, simply follow these steps:
Step 1: Launch the Hatch Sleep app.
Step 2: Navigate to the Wake Up section.
Step 3: Locate the alarm you wish to turn off.
Step 4: Toggle it to the Off position. An indicator will then show that you have No Active Alarms.
Step 5: To turn your alarms back on, tap the Show Disabled Alarms message, find your alarm, and move the toggle back to the On position.
Step 6: You’re all set! Just make sure to keep the app open until the “Saving” notification disappears — closing it prematurely may cause your changes not to save.

Snoozing and Stopping the Hatch Restore 3 Alarm
In addition to turning alarms on and off, the Hatch Restore 3 features a large button on its top that acts as a snooze control. When your alarm goes off in the morning, simply tap this button for a snooze, or press and hold it to turn the alarm off completely. You can also touch the front face of the Restore 3 to quickly check the current time, giving you the chance to decide whether to hit snooze or start your day early.
